강의로 돌아가기
-

기본형타입 double 관련 질문입니다.

정수형타입 long과 실수형타입 float는

값 뒤에 알파벳 L 과 F 를 붙여주는데

long bing = 345455433L;
float f = 32.4F;

double은 붙여도 상관없나요?

동영상 강의에서는 안붙이고 끝내셔서...

이클립스에서 해보니 붙여도 결과값은 출력이 되는데

답변 부탁드립니다. 궁금합니다~

1 개의 답변
-

자바에서 실수형은 double이 기본형이기 때문에 실수 뒤에 아무것도 붙이지 않으면 double형으로 선언됩니다.
때문에 float로 선언하고 뒤에 f를 붙여주지 않으면 컴파일 에러가 발생하는거죠.

답변 쓰기
이 입력폼은 마크다운 문법을 지원합니다. 마크다운 가이드 를 참고하세요.